More about the book

In "White," Bret Easton Ellis critiques contemporary leftist ideologies, targeting anti-Trump sentiment, identity politics, and cultural censorship. This provocative nonfiction work challenges societal norms and advocates for free speech amidst a polarized America, igniting discussions on artistic freedom and political correctness.
